Transaction 2c99e4ca0f024116bb6e95aa4da034ee1fc339056f4174680db9a89fb2fdd07a

3 Input
2 Outputs
  • 2c99e4ca0f024116bb6e95aa4da034ee1fc339056f4174680db9a89fb2fdd07a:0
  • value  18403490000
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 2c99e4ca0f024116bb6e95aa4da034ee1fc339056f4174680db9a89fb2fdd07a:1
  • value  13154883382
    address  3ATP3WmCHVWoKYDNTGWZ2xLzNgaPkgTq3q